Apparatus for the measurement of microwave radiation

Apparatus for measuring the power of intense microwave pulses comprises a conducting track (3) formed on an insulating substrate (1, 2) and coupled to radiation from a remote source (10) via an antenna (7) and transmission line (6). The subsequent heating of the track (3) brings about a change in its resistance, which is monitored by a constant current source (8) and voltmeter (9). The degree of resistance change gives an indication of the energy content of the microwave pulse.
